Eligibility and Entrance Exams

To enroll in beginning architecture courses in India, students typically need to finish their 12th-grade schooling. The majority of institutions demand a foundation in mathematics and science. Nevertheless, depending on the course design, some programs also admit students from the arts or commerce streams.

The two main entrance exams for architecture admissions in India are JEE Main (Paper 2) and the National Aptitude Test in Architecture (NATA). These tests evaluate your ability to draw, use logic, and comprehend architectural ideas. Being well-prepared for these can lead to admission to reputable universities in Mumbai and throughout India that offer architecture courses.

Online vs Offline Architecture Courses

Many students wonder if online architecture courses are beneficial in light of the growing popularity of digital learning. Online classes are useful for understanding the fundamentals of software, theory, and design, but nothing can substitute practical experience. Model building, site visits, and real-time feedback are all necessary for architecture, and offline classes are the most effective way to accomplish these goals.

Combining the two approaches, though, can work well. For example, you can attend offline studio sessions while learning design tools online. Students in architecture programs in Mumbai and other large cities are increasingly choosing this hybrid method.
